The Snowflake Global HR Compliance Team is expanding, and we’re looking for an HR Compliance Analyst to join us in scaling our program to meet the demands of a growing business. This role will have compliance related duties and responsibilities across HR with a focus on government reporting, audit response and support, controls testing, and compliance process design and implementation.


The HR Compliance Analyst role is an in-office hybrid position located in either our Dublin, CA or San Mateo, CA office.


AS AN HR COMPLIANCE ANALYST AT SNOWFLAKE, YOU WILL:

  • Assist and support HR with initial compliance and ongoing preparation, testing, and monitoring of conformance to the requirements of legislation, regulations, company policies, and contract commitments.
  • Work with control owners to coordinate responses to internal and external compliance audits and requests from customers or government entities.
  • Assist with the scoping and implementation of compliance requirements across all HR functions.
  • Manage the completion of regulatory compliance report filings (e.g., EEO-1, AAP, VETS, Pay Equity, etc.) through collaboration with stakeholders.
  • Request and process reports in support of HR controls and audits.
  • Escalate any HR compliance concerns to the Sr. Manager of Global HR Compliance Programs with recommendations for possible corrective action.
  • Support labor law posting requirements.


OUR IDEAL HR COMPLIANCE ANALYST WILL HAVE:

At a minimum

  • 3 years of experience in an HR Compliance or HR Generalist role with HR compliance responsibilities.
  • Demonstrated ability to use a consultative approach with all levels of management.
  • Demonstrated ability to think critically and analyze and communicate complex information to all levels of the organization.
  • Ability to multi-task effectively and meet deadlines with limited supervision.


Preferably

  • Strong familiarity with SOX, SOC, FedRAMP, USR and USRA+ compliance processes and controls.
  • Experience with mandatory government reporting in and outside the US.
  • Experience working in a fast-pace, high-growth tech company.

The following represents the expected range of compensation for this role:

  • The estimated base salary range for this role is $90,000 - $119,700.
  • Additionally, this role is eligible to participate in Snowflake’s bonus and equity plan.


The successful candidate’s starting salary will be determined based on permissible, non-discriminatory factors such as skills, experience, and geographic location. This role is also eligible for a competitive benefits package that includes: medical, dental, vision, life, and disability insurance; 401(k) retirement plan; flexible spending & health savings account; at least 12 paid holidays; paid time off; parental leave; employee assistance program; and other company benefits.
